Postby Orlando Penguin » Tue Nov 05, 2019 10:06 am

Games tip today. Featured matches include...

#1 Sparty vs #2 Kentucky
#3 Kansas vs #4 Puke
St. Mary’s favored in a neutral site game vs Wisconsin
A trio of ACC conference openers (Louisville at Miami, VA Tech at Clemson, GA Tech at NC State)

Of board interest:

MD-Eastern Shore at Penn State
GW at Towson
Something called Malone College at Akron
Sacred Heart at Providence
Army at Villanova

Tomorrow - Florida State at Pitt, Bryant at Rutgers

Orlando Penguin
Posts: 11337
Joined: Wed Mar 25, 2015 8:04 pm
Location: Orlando, FL

2019-2020 College Basketball Thread

Postby Orlando Penguin » Tue Nov 12, 2019 9:24 pm

I watched the last 7 minutes and Kentucky was god-awful on the offensive end. Numerous chances to pull even and take the lead and they couldn't do it. Evansville was a 26 1/2 point dog and picked 8th in the MVC. They're coached by former Kentucky player Walter McCarty (TIL).
